The nostalgia of childhood gaming continues to bring joy to many people around the world. One classic franchise that has captured the hearts of fans is Doraemon, a beloved Japanese manga and anime series created by Fujiko F. Fujio. The series follows the adventures of a robotic cat named Doraemon, who travels from the future to help his human friend Noby on various missions.
